#3e16cc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3e16cc is composed of 24.3% red, 8.6%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.6% cyan, 89.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 253.2 degrees, a saturation of 80.5% and a lightness of 44.3%. #3e16cc color hex could be obtained by blending #7c2cff with #000099.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

Shades and Tints of #3e16cc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030109 is the darkest color, while #f8f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3e16cc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f6d75 is the less saturated color, while #3405dd is the most saturated one.
